Terra Alia v1.0.1
CODEX – TORRENT – FREE DOWNLOAD – CRACKED
Terra Alia – You’ve arrived at Terra Alia, a world where magic and technology shape the future. Embark on an adventure and solve a thrilling mystery while practicing...